With the release of iOS 26.5 and the iPhone 17 series, the MFi R47 certification specification has undergone significant adjustments. Hongbiao Certification has summarized the major changes involving connector certification, audio standards, and the BLE accessory ecosystem as follows.


I. Update Content: Core Rule Adjustments
1.USB-C Connector Certification Changes
Before: USB-C connectors or receptacles required "USB-IF TID certification."
After: Changed to "Connectors must comply with the USB Type-C Cable and Connector Specification, version 2.3."

This adjustment simplifies the certification process, eliminating the need for manufacturers to separately apply for USB-IF TID certification. However, they must ensure that the connectors fully meet the detailed mechanical, electrical, and performance requirements specified in the USB Type-C 2.3 specification.

2.BLE Bluetooth Data Packet Capacity Definition
A new definition has been added: BLE Bluetooth now explicitly specifies the minimum capacity for a single data packet as 600 bytes.

This standard provides clear underlying protocol support for BLE accessories (such as game controllers, keyboards, and mice) in scenarios involving high-volume data transmission, such as firmware OTA updates and high-definition haptic feedback. It contributes to improved transmission efficiency and stability.

3.USB Host Mode Audio Sampling Rate Requirements
Before: It was recommended to support 48KHz standard lossless and 192KHz Hi-Res lossless.
After: Revised to recommend support for 192KHz Hi-Res lossless.
The specification further narrows the audio standard, elevating the high-fidelity requirements for USB-C audio accessories. Manufacturers should prioritize ensuring seamless compatibility with 192KHz sampling rates when designing DAC chips and firmware.


4.Vconn Power Supply Testing for USB-C Accessories
A new requirement has been added: For USB-C accessories, a test requirement stipulates that "when connected to the iPhone Air, the accessory must be able to draw power from the Vconn pin and operate normally."

This clarifies the scenario where the iPhone Air model provides power to peripherals via the USB-C interface. Accessory designs must account for the stability and compatibility testing of the power circuitry drawing from the Vconn pin.



5.Compatibility and System Version Threshold
System Requirements Update:
Before: Required to run on iOS 18.6 or later.
After: Now requires iOS 26.5 or later.

The minimum compatible Apple devices have been updated from "running iOS 18.6 or later" to "requiring iOS 26.5 or later." Additionally, compatibility now includes the iPhone 17 series models, iPads equipped with M4 and M5 chips, as well as Apple Watch 11 and Ultra 3.

II. Additions: New BLE Bluetooth Features and Implementation
1.New BLE Bluetooth App Match and App Launch Features
Function Definitions:
App Match (BLE Version): When a user connects a BLE accessory for the first time, the system displays a pop-up prompt suggesting the download of the companion app.
App Launch (BLE Version): When a user connects a BLE accessory and the companion app is already installed, the system automatically launches the app.

Primary Use Cases:​ This functionality is primarily intended for BLE entertainment accessories, such as game controllers, aiming to deliver a seamless "connect-and-play" experience similar to that of AirPods.
图片
2.Technical Requirements for Feature Implementation
To achieve the BLE App Match and App Launch features described above, accessories must meet the following technical requirements:
System Environment: The features are supported on iPhones and iPads running iOS 26.0 or later.
Hardware Requirements: Accessories must integrate Apple 4.0 chips and utilize BLE Bluetooth connections.
Protocol Requirements:

  • The accessory’s Bluetooth advertisements must include the Authenticated Accessory Capability​ service.
  • The accessory must be capable of accepting L2CAP CoC connection requests on the advertising PSM.

3. Comparison of App Launch Capabilities: BLE vs. iAP2

The table below compares the differences in implementing the App Launch feature between BLE Bluetooth​ and iAP2​ (Classic Bluetooth):

Feature / Requirement
iAP2 App Launch
BLE App Launch
Launch App with Specified Bundle ID
✅ Yes
❌ No
Launch "Game" Category Apps
✅ Yes
✅ Yes (System Decides)
Launch Apple Arcade
✅ Yes
✅ Yes
Pass Parameters / Deep Link
✅ Yes
❌ No
Accessory Active Control
✅ Yes
❌ No, only trigger signal
Requires MFi Chip
✅ Yes
✅ Yes

Summary

The MFi R47 specification enhances fundamental compatibility by introducing the USB-C 2.3 standard​ and raising the minimum system requirement to iOS 26.5. On the other hand, it brings more convenient interaction experiences for accessories like game controllers through new BLE features. Manufacturers are advised to promptly adjust their hardware designs and software development according to the new requirements to ensure smooth certification and compatibility with the new generation of Apple devices.
